A little friendly competition never hurt anyone. Cheer on your favorite teams or pick a new team to root for. Charleston is home to minor league baseball, professional soccer, tennis and hockey. There's sports-centered entertainment year round so you don't have to miss a second of the action.
Charleston RiverDogs Baseball / Joseph P. Riley, Jr. Park
The RiverDogs are a Rays affiliate known for fun, affordable, family-friendly entertainment. Food choices have been featured in Esquire, Man v. Food, Rachael Ray and more.
The Citadel Bulldogs compete in NCAA Division I and has had an affiliation with the Southern Conference since 1936. Features 16 men's and women's varsity sports teams.
Features 21 NCAA Division I sports & over 400 student-athletes. Hosts over 200 intercollegiate events a year. Downtown campus includes TD Arena, a modern 5,100 seat facility.
